The single spawn-armed timer charged API queue latency to the work budget: the recurring '0 turns / $0.00 / x3 attempts' failure with four budget-bump receipts (180->300s, 240->360s, 300->420s, 90->300s). Split: startup phase (no NDJSON byte yet) kills EARLY at min(grace, timeout) with the distinct exitReason 'timeout_startup' — an availability verdict, not transcript archaeology — and the work phase arms on the first byte for the REMAINING budget, so total wall never exceeds the timeout (tier envelopes are margin-free: tests pass timeout: CAPTURE_MS and bun-budget the same tier). Local grace 90s (observed queue latency 60-90s), CI floor 300s (TODOS-filed; shared runners queue harder), both pinned by the new grace tests with fake -claude shims covering the late-first-byte and silent-API paths.
